Certificate IV in Cleaning Management - CPP40416

This qualification reflects the role of cleaning industry personnel who use well developed skills and a broad knowledge base in a wide variety of cleaning management contexts. They may be responsible for wide-ranging operational cleaning management activity and for managing staff, providing quotations, planning and overseeing work, and providing customer support.No licensing, legislative, regulatory, or certification requirements apply to this qualification at the time of endorsement.
Structure
- 14 units: 7 core
- 7 elective
Subjects
- Develop workplace policies and procedures for sustainability
- Manage workplace safety arrangements
- Provide quotation for cleaning services
- Manage risk
- Develop a plan to mitigate water damage and restore carpets
- Establish, develop and monitor teams
- Manage the supply of cleaning stores to the work site
- Induct cleaning staff
- Schedule and monitor cleaning tasks
- Inspect sites prior to carpet cleaning
- Implement and monitor infection prevention and control policies and procedures
- Develop, implement and monitor new cleaning techniques
- Manage cleaning equipment maintenance and supply
- Confirm and apply privacy and security requirements for cleaning work
- Implement and monitor environmentally sustainable work practices
- Develop and manage client relations
